Dynamodb write sharding
WebFeb 28, 2024 · On reaching the threshold like 10GB of size or 3000 RCU or 1000 WCU DynamoDB will create new partition and move S2 key in new partition i.e. partition1_0. WebAug 1, 2024 · Amazon DynamoDB has two read/write capacity modes for processing reads and writes on your tables: On-demand. Provisioned. The read/write capacity mode …
Dynamodb write sharding
Did you know?
WebFeb 20, 2024 · To make it easier to read individual items, consider sharding by using calculated suffixes, as explained in Using Write Sharding to Distribute Workloads Evenly in the DynamoDB Developer Guide. WebJun 1, 2024 · Lazy Sharding Lazy Sharding. Basically, the idea here is to only write-shard the partition if our requests are being throttled. If they are, run a de-sharding strategy to rewrite the items to a single partition, while DynamoDB takes care of the repartitioning. When reading, also perform an attemptive read on the main partition first, only ...
WebSep 16, 2014 · A quick question: while writing a query in any database, ... Item sharding. Sharding, also called horizontal partitioning, is a technique in which rows are distributed among the database servers to perform queries faster. ... After a point of time, we put 10 more items into the table. DynamoDB will create another partition (by hashing over the ... WebBy default, the throughput quota placed on your table is 40,000 read requests units and 40,000 write requests units. If the traffic to your table exceeds this quota, then the table might be throttled. To resolve this issue, use the Service Quotas console to increase the table-level read or write throughput quota for your account.
WebDec 20, 2024 · Use DynamoDB streams to process data and write aggregations back to your DynamoDB table and/or other services that are better at handling those types of access patterns. Lambda functions …
WebA dynamodb stream consists of stream records which are grouped into shards. A shard can spawn child shards in response to high number of writes on the dynamodb table. So …
WebFeb 1, 2024 · Amazon DynamoDB is a NoSQL Database offering from AWS, and it is built on the premise of speed and availability. ... This blog highlights the benefits of sharding, … grace rughWebUsing the DynamoDB Well-Architected Lens to optimize your DynamoDB workload Best practices for designing and using partition keys effectively Best practices for using sort keys to organize data Best practices for using secondary indexes in DynamoDB Best practices for storing large items and attributes grace russell texasWebJul 9, 2014 · One way to better distribute writes across a partition key space in Amazon DynamoDB is to expand the space. You can do this in several different ways. You can … chill mat targusWebSep 30, 2024 · Mapping is the process in which you define a partition scheme, secondary indexes, and write sharding (if your design requires it). Fantasy football game database (ERD and access patterns) Whether you’re building a new application with DynamoDB or migrating from another data store, a common first step in the data modeling process is to … chillmax beverage solutionsWebЯ вставляю данные timestamp и status в DynamoDb когда когда когда когда когда-либо приходят новые данные. ... используйте sharding подход: на write хранить самые новые данные рандомно в одной из N записей, а на ... grace ruth battenWebJul 28, 2024 · The GSI is also modified to have Hash/Partition key as GroupId_Shard instead of GroupId that was used earlier.. With this approach when 4 million customers are written in CustomerAssociation table, an additional column GroupId_Shard will also be populated.As the GSI is created with GroupId_Shard as partition key the 4 million … chill max bef-05WebJul 16, 2024 · Shards in DynamoDB streams are collections of stream records. Each stream record represents a single data modification in the DynamoDB table to which the stream belongs. The following diagram … chillmax bar fridge